A system in China that ranks households according to the amount of their assets. Under the equal-field system from the Northern Wei dynasty to the Tang dynasty (5th to early 10th centuries), there was a 3rd to 9th class household system, but it only played a secondary role in adjusting the disparity in wealth that arose under the equal-field system. It was during the Song dynasty that the household rank system was established as a standard for the dynasty's control of the people. According to the amount of assets, head households were ranked into 10th class in cities and 5th class in rural areas. A household rank register was compiled every three years to allow households to be promoted or demoted. These were called the Five-Class Dingyuan Register and the Five-Class Household Register.
